在当前数字化转型的大潮中,企业越来越多地依赖于在线报表系统来进行数据分析和决策支持。FineReport作为一款领先的企业级web报表工具,提供了强大的功能,可以帮助企业轻松制作复杂的报表。本文将详细介绍如何使用在线报表系统来制作表格,帮助企业更高效地管理和分析数据。

在线报表系统如何制作表格
一、了解在线报表系统的基本功能
在线报表系统的基本功能包括数据连接、报表设计、数据分析和报表发布。了解这些功能是制作表格的第一步。
1. 数据连接
要制作表格,首先需要将数据源与报表系统连接。FineReport支持多种数据源,包括MySQL、Oracle、SQL Server等数据库,以及Excel、CSV等文件格式。通过简单的配置,即可将数据源与报表系统连接,开始数据处理。
2. 报表设计
报表设计是在线报表系统的核心功能。FineReport提供了丰富的报表设计工具,用户可以通过拖拽操作轻松制作各种类型的表格,包括简单的列表报表、交叉报表、图表等。设计过程中,用户可以设置表格的样式、格式以及数据的展示方式。
3. 数据分析
在线报表系统不仅仅是展示数据,更重要的是提供数据分析功能。FineReport内置了多种数据分析工具,用户可以对数据进行筛选、排序、分组、汇总等操作,帮助企业深入挖掘数据价值。
4. 报表发布
制作好的表格需要发布到Web端供用户查看。FineReport支持将报表发布到Web浏览器中,用户可以通过访问URL查看和操作报表。此外,FineReport还支持将报表导出为Excel、PDF等格式,方便数据分享和存档。
二、在线报表系统制作表格的步骤
制作表格的具体步骤包括数据准备、设计表格、添加图表、设置参数和发布报表。以下是详细步骤:
1. 数据准备
首先,需要准备好用于制作表格的数据。数据可以来源于数据库、Excel文件或其他数据源。在FineReport中,用户可以通过数据连接功能将数据源与报表系统连接。
2. 设计表格
在FineReport的设计器中,用户可以通过拖拽操作轻松设计表格。用户可以选择不同的表格模板,设置表格的行列结构、样式和格式。FineReport还提供了丰富的图表组件,用户可以将图表与表格结合,提升数据展示效果。
3. 添加图表
在表格中添加图表可以使数据展示更加直观。FineReport支持多种图表类型,包括柱状图、折线图、饼图等。用户可以根据数据特点选择合适的图表类型,通过简单的设置即可将图表添加到表格中。
4. 设置参数
为了使报表更加灵活,用户可以在FineReport中设置参数。参数可以用来控制数据的筛选条件、报表的展示内容等。通过设置参数,用户可以实现报表的动态展示,满足不同用户的需求。
5. 发布报表
设计好的表格需要发布到Web端供用户查看。在FineReport中,用户可以通过简单的设置将报表发布到Web浏览器中,用户可以通过访问URL查看和操作报表。此外,FineReport还支持将报表导出为Excel、PDF等格式,方便数据分享和存档。
三、如何优化表格展示效果
优化表格展示效果可以提升用户体验,使数据展示更加清晰、直观。以下是一些优化表格展示效果的方法:
1. 使用合适的表格样式
选择合适的表格样式是优化表格展示效果的关键。FineReport提供了多种表格样式,用户可以根据数据特点选择合适的样式,使表格展示更加美观。
2. 设置条件格式
条件格式可以帮助用户突出显示重要数据。在FineReport中,用户可以通过设置条件格式,使特定条件下的数据以不同的颜色、字体或背景展示,提升数据可读性。
3. 添加图表和数据可视化组件
在表格中添加图表和数据可视化组件可以使数据展示更加直观。FineReport支持多种图表类型,用户可以根据数据特点选择合适的图表类型,通过简单的设置即可将图表添加到表格中。
4. 优化数据加载速度
数据加载速度是影响用户体验的重要因素。FineReport提供了多种数据优化技术,包括数据缓存、分布式计算等,用户可以根据数据量和系统性能选择合适的优化策略,提升数据加载速度。
四、FineReport如何简化报表制作流程
FineReport作为一款专业的报表工具,提供了丰富的功能,可以大大简化报表制作流程。以下是FineReport在报表制作中的一些优势:
1. 简单易用的设计器
FineReport的设计器界面简洁友好,用户可以通过拖拽操作轻松设计报表。即使没有编程经验的用户,也可以快速上手,制作出专业的报表。
2. 强大的数据处理能力
FineReport支持多种数据源的连接,用户可以通过简单的配置将数据源与报表系统连接。FineReport内置了多种数据处理工具,用户可以对数据进行筛选、排序、分组、汇总等操作,帮助企业深入挖掘数据价值。
3. 丰富的图表组件
FineReport提供了多种图表组件,用户可以根据数据特点选择合适的图表类型,通过简单的设置即可将图表添加到报表中。图表组件的丰富性使得数据展示更加直观、清晰。
4. 灵活的报表发布方式
FineReport支持将报表发布到Web浏览器中,用户可以通过访问URL查看和操作报表。此外,FineReport还支持将报表导出为Excel、PDF等格式,方便数据分享和存档。
五、在线报表系统的应用场景
在线报表系统在企业中的应用非常广泛,以下是一些典型的应用场景:
1. 业务数据分析
企业可以使用在线报表系统对业务数据进行分析,包括销售数据、财务数据、库存数据等。通过制作报表,企业可以直观地看到业务数据的变化趋势,及时调整经营策略。
2. 绩效管理
在线报表系统可以帮助企业进行绩效管理。企业可以通过制作绩效报表,跟踪员工的工作情况,评估员工的绩效,制定合理的绩效考核标准。
3. 数据共享与协作
在线报表系统可以实现数据的共享与协作。企业内部的不同部门可以通过在线报表系统共享数据,协同工作,提高工作效率。
4. 客户关系管理
企业可以使用在线报表系统进行客户关系管理。通过制作客户报表,企业可以了解客户的需求和行为,制定针对性的营销策略,提升客户满意度。
六、总结
在线报表系统如何制作表格是每个企业在数字化转型过程中都需要掌握的重要技能。通过了解在线报表系统的基本功能,掌握制作表格的具体步骤,优化表格展示效果,企业可以更高效地管理和分析数据,提升业务决策能力。FineReport作为一款专业的报表工具,以其简单易用、功能强大的特点,成为企业制作报表的首选工具。立即下载FineReport,开始您的报表制作之旅:https://s.fanruan.com/v6agx。
本文相关FAQs
如何选择适合的在线报表工具?
在选择在线报表工具时,需要考虑以下几个关键因素:
- 功能需求:
- 数据处理能力:能够处理大数据量,并提供快速响应的查询和分析功能。
- 报表设计:是否支持复杂报表的设计,是否提供丰富的可视化组件,如图表、表格、仪表盘等。
- 自定义开发:是否支持二次开发,满足企业特定需求。
- 导出及打印功能:是否支持多种格式导出,如PDF、Excel、Word等,是否支持高质量打印。
- 易用性:
- 用户界面:是否友好、直观,是否支持拖拽操作,减少技术门槛。
- 文档及支持:是否提供详尽的使用文档、教程及技术支持,帮助用户快速上手。
- 性能与稳定性:
- 系统性能:报表生成速度,系统稳定性,是否能够在高并发访问情况下保持性能。
- 扩展性:是否支持系统扩展,适应企业未来发展需求。
- 安全性:
- 数据安全:是否提供完善的数据权限控制机制,确保数据安全。
- 系统安全:是否具备防护措施,防止数据泄露和系统攻击。
- 成本:
- 软件费用:包括购买成本、维护成本及升级费用。
- 隐性成本:如培训费用、开发费用等。
其中,FineReport 是一个强大的选择。FineReport 支持复杂报表设计,提供丰富的可视化组件,并且支持二次开发,满足企业的特定需求。同时,它拥有友好的用户界面,支持拖拽操作,并提供详尽的使用文档和技术支持。此外,FineReport 在性能、稳定性和安全性方面表现出色,能够满足大多数企业的需求。
如何在在线报表系统中设计复杂报表?
设计复杂报表时,需要考虑以下几个方面:
- 确定需求:
- 明确报表的目标和用途,确定需要展示的数据和指标。
- 确认数据来源,确保数据的准确性和及时性。
- 数据准备:
- 数据清洗:处理数据中的缺失值、异常值,确保数据质量。
- 数据转换:根据需求对数据进行转换和计算,如汇总、分组等。
- 报表结构设计:
- 确定报表的布局和结构,如分栏、分区等。
- 选择合适的图表和表格类型,确保信息的有效传达。
- 添加必要的过滤器、排序和分页功能,提高报表的交互性和易用性。
- 报表制作:
- 使用报表工具的设计器进行报表的制作,FineReport 支持拖拽操作,简化设计过程。
- 添加数据源和数据集,配置数据绑定。
- 进行格式化设置,如字体、颜色、边框等,提升报表的美观性。
- 测试与优化:
- 进行报表测试,检查数据的准确性和展示效果。
- 根据反馈进行优化,如调整布局、增加注释等。
- 优化报表的性能,确保报表生成速度和系统响应速度。
- 发布与维护:
- 将报表发布到在线报表系统中,设置访问权限。
- 定期维护和更新报表,确保数据的及时性和准确性。
在这个过程中,FineReport 提供了强大的功能支持,如丰富的图表和表格组件、强大的数据处理能力和灵活的报表设计器,能够帮助用户高效地设计和制作复杂报表。
如何实现在线报表系统的二次开发?
在实现在线报表系统的二次开发时,需要考虑以下几个方面:
- 确定开发需求:
- 明确二次开发的目标和具体需求,确定需要实现的功能和特性。
- 确认开发的技术栈和工具,选择合适的开发语言和框架。
- 搭建开发环境:
- 安装和配置开发所需的软件和工具,如开发环境、数据库、报表工具等。
- 配置报表工具的开发接口和SDK,FineReport 提供了丰富的API接口和开发文档,方便开发者进行二次开发。
- 进行系统设计:
- 设计系统的整体架构和模块划分,明确各模块的功能和接口。
- 设计数据库结构和数据表,确保数据的规范和一致性。
- 开发实现:
- 编写代码实现各功能模块,FineReport 提供了多种编程接口,如Java、JavaScript等,支持开发者进行灵活的二次开发。
- 进行单元测试和集成测试,确保各模块功能的正确性和稳定性。
- 集成与发布:
- 将开发完成的功能集成到在线报表系统中,进行系统测试和性能优化。
- 将系统发布到生产环境,设置访问权限和安全策略。
- 维护与更新:
- 定期维护系统,修复可能出现的bug和问题。
- 根据用户反馈和需求,进行功能的更新和优化。
在这个过程中,FineReport 提供了全面的支持,如丰富的API接口、详尽的开发文档和技术支持,帮助开发者顺利进行二次开发,满足企业的特定需求。
如何提高在线报表系统的性能?
提高在线报表系统的性能,可以从以下几个方面入手:
- 优化数据源:
- 选择高效的数据存储和查询方式:如使用索引、分区等技术,提高数据查询的效率。
- 减少数据量:仅查询和展示必要的数据,避免过多的数据加载和传输。
- 优化报表设计:
- 简化报表结构:减少不必要的复杂计算和展示,优化报表的布局和结构。
- 使用高效的图表和表格组件:选择合适的可视化组件,提高数据的展示效率。
- 分页和分批加载:对于数据量较大的报表,使用分页和分批加载技术,减少一次性加载的数据量。
- 优化系统架构:
- 使用缓存技术:对于频繁访问的数据和报表,使用缓存技术减少数据库查询和计算,提高系统响应速度。
- 负载均衡:对于高并发访问的系统,使用负载均衡技术分摊请求,避免单点故障和性能瓶颈。
- 优化代码和算法:
- 编写高效的代码:避免冗余和低效的代码,优化算法和数据处理逻辑。
- 进行性能测试和优化:通过性能测试工具分析系统性能瓶颈,进行针对性的优化。
- 硬件和网络优化:
- 选择高性能的服务器和存储设备:提高系统的硬件性能,支持高并发访问和大数据量处理。
- 优化网络配置:提高网络带宽和稳定性,减少网络延迟和传输时间。
在这个过程中,FineReport 提供了多种性能优化的工具和技术支持,如缓存机制、负载均衡、分页加载等,帮助用户提高在线报表系统的性能,满足企业的高性能需求。
如何确保在线报表系统的数据安全?
确保在线报表系统的数据安全,需要从以下几个方面入手:
- 数据权限控制:
- 角色和权限管理:根据用户角色设置不同的数据访问权限,确保数据的安全性和保密性。
- 数据加密:对敏感数据进行加密存储和传输,防止数据泄露和篡改。
- 系统安全防护:
- 身份认证和授权:使用安全的身份认证和授权机制,如单点登录、OAuth等,确保用户身份的真实性和合法性。
- 防火墙和入侵检测:部署防火墙和入侵检测系统,防止外部攻击和非法访问。
- 数据备份和恢复:
- 定期数据备份:对重要数据进行定期备份,防止数据丢失和损坏。
- 数据恢复机制:建立数据恢复机制,确保在数据丢失或损坏时能够快速恢复。
- 日志和监控:
- 操作日志记录:记录系统操作日志,便于审计和追踪。
- 系统监控:对系统进行实时监控,及时发现和处理安全问题。
- 安全培训和意识:
- 安全培训:对系统管理员和用户进行安全培训,增强安全意识和技能。
- 安全政策和规范:制定和实施安全政策和规范,确保系统的安全管理和操作。
在这个过程中,FineReport 提供了多种安全功能和技术支持,如数据权限控制、身份认证、数据加密等,帮助用户确保在线报表系统的数据安全,满足企业的安全需求。